Surgeons perform aortic valve replacement using three primary methods: surgical aortic valve replacement (SAVR) via sternotomy, minimally invasive surgery, or transcatheter aortic valve replacement (TAVR). These techniques replace diseased valves with mechanical or biological prosthetics to restore proper blood flow through the heart.

Mechanical valves typically last 20 to 30 years or more. They often serve a lifetime but require permanent blood thinners. Tissue valves, made from animal cells, usually last 10 to 20 years. These avoid lifelong medication but often require a future replacement surgery.

Medical suitability for trans-catheter aortic valve implantation (TAVI) focuses on patients with high surgical risk, advanced frailty, or severe comorbidities. Candidates typically include those over 75 with calcified aortas or lung disease. Optimal eligibility requires healthy femoral arteries for catheter access and specific aortic anatomy confirmed via CT angiography.
